US Sanctions Cuban President, Escalates Pressure on Communist Leadership

- The U.S. Treasury Department announced sanctions on Thursday against Cuban President Miguel Diaz-Canel, four other individuals, and five entities, including the Ministry of the Revolutionary Armed Forces. This is the latest move by Washington to increase pressure on Cuba's communist leadership. President Donald Trump stated the U.S. wants Cuba to be a "well-governed country." The Cuban government has not yet responded.
